Job Description
SPECTRAFORCE is hiring a Safety Specialist in Westborough, MA, for an 11-month contract focusing on Dangerous Goods compliance. Responsibilities include developing a document repository, reviewing compliance entries, processing transportation requests, and training staff. Candidates should have a relevant degree and at least one year of EHS experience, with knowledge of OSHA and DOT regulations. The position requires strong communication and analytical skills.
